Blame completions/groupmod
|
Packit |
8462d6 |
# groupmod(8) completion -*- shell-script -*-
|
|
Packit |
8462d6 |
|
|
Packit |
8462d6 |
_groupmod()
|
|
Packit |
8462d6 |
{
|
|
Packit |
8462d6 |
local cur prev words cword split
|
|
Packit |
8462d6 |
_init_completion -s || return
|
|
Packit |
8462d6 |
|
|
Packit |
8462d6 |
# TODO: if -o/--non-unique is given, could complete on existing gids
|
|
Packit |
8462d6 |
# with -g/--gid
|
|
Packit |
8462d6 |
|
|
Packit |
8462d6 |
case $prev in
|
|
Packit |
8462d6 |
-g|--gid|-h|--help|-n|--new-name|-p|--password)
|
|
Packit |
8462d6 |
return
|
|
Packit |
8462d6 |
;;
|
|
Packit |
8462d6 |
esac
|
|
Packit |
8462d6 |
|
|
Packit |
8462d6 |
$split && return
|
|
Packit |
8462d6 |
|
|
Packit |
8462d6 |
if [[ "$cur" == -* ]]; then
|
|
Packit |
8462d6 |
COMPREPLY=( $( compgen -W '$( _parse_help "$1" )' -- "$cur" ) )
|
|
Packit |
8462d6 |
[[ $COMPREPLY == *= ]] && compopt -o nospace
|
|
Packit |
8462d6 |
return
|
|
Packit |
8462d6 |
fi
|
|
Packit |
8462d6 |
|
|
Packit |
8462d6 |
COMPREPLY=( $( compgen -g -- "$cur" ) )
|
|
Packit |
8462d6 |
} &&
|
|
Packit |
8462d6 |
complete -F _groupmod groupmod
|
|
Packit |
8462d6 |
|
|
Packit |
8462d6 |
# ex: filetype=sh
|